[gate-users] Installation with gcc 2.96

Jianfeng He jfenghe at petnm.unimelb.edu.au
Thu Oct 27 04:28:37 CEST 2005


Dear Gate users,

Has anybody installed Gate using gcc2.96 before? I am trying to install
Gate on cluster supercomputers called VAPAC. But the gcc version running
on VAPAC is 2.96 while the required gcc version of Gate for installing
is at least 3.2 

I got the following error messages with gcc2.96 during Gate compiling:

Compiling GateDistributionManualMessenger.cc ...
Compiling GateDistributionMessenger.cc ...
src/GateDistributionMessenger.cc:76: prototype for `G4String
GateDistributionMessenger::withUnity (double, G4String)' does not match
any in class `GateDistributionMessenger'
include/GateDistributionMessenger.hh:42: candidate is: G4String
GateDistributionMessenger::withUnity
(double, G4String) const
src/GateDistributionMessenger.cc: In method `G4String
GateDistributionMessenger::withUnity (double, G4String)':
src/GateDistributionMessenger.cc:77: `::ostringstream' undeclared
(first use here)
src/GateDistributionMessenger.cc:77: parse error before `;'
src/GateDistributionMessenger.cc:79: `ss' undeclared (first use this
function)
src/GateDistributionMessenger.cc:79: (Each undeclared identifier is
reported only once for each function it appears in.)
make: *** [/home/san05/jianfeng/geant4/geant4.7.0.p01/tmp/Linux-g+
+/Gate/GateDistributionMessenger.o] Error 1

Is it a problem about the compatibility between gcc2.96 and gcc3.2?

Would appreciate your suggestions or experiences!

Jianfeng






More information about the Gate-users mailing list